(100 . "AcDbAlignedDimension") in ssget fliter
« on: April 10, 2014, 04:54:53 AM »
I found "(100 . "AcDbAlignedDimension")" is not affect in ssget fliter

(ssget '((0 . "DIMENSION")(100 . "AcDbAlignedDimension"))) this will selete all type of dimension(such as DbOrdinateDimension,AcDbArcDimension)
(ssget '((100 . "AcDbAlignedDimension"))) this will selete all type of entities


Did I write something wrong?

What you are saying is not correct.

The only problem I see:
Code: [Select]
(ssget "_A" '((100 . "AcDbAlignedDimension"))) ; => Will also select rotated dimensions.My solution:
Code: [Select]
(ssget "_A" '((100 . "AcDbAlignedDimension") (-4 . "<NOT") (100 . "AcDbRotatedDimension") (-4 . "NOT>")))

You could alternatively use the following ssget filter list to include only Aligned dimensions:

Code: [Select]
(
    (0 . "DIMENSION")
    (-4 . "<OR")
        (70 . 001)
        (70 . 033)
        (70 . 065)
        (70 . 097)
        (70 . 129)
        (70 . 161)
        (70 . 193)
        (70 . 225)
    (-4 . "OR>")
)

Or:
Code: [Select]
(ssget "_A" ((0 . "DIMENSION") (-4 . "&") (70 . 1)))

Unfortunately, DXF group 70 for dimensions is not truly bit-coded - I believe your code would also select Diameter & Angular 3-Point dimensions, in addition to Aligned dimensions.

For a more functional approach, perhaps something like:

Code: [Select]
(defun dim-filter ( typ )
    (append
       '((0 . "*DIMENSION") (-4 . "<OR"))
        (mapcar '(lambda ( x ) (cons 70 (+ typ x))) (bit-combinations '(32 64 128)))
       '((-4 . "OR>"))
    )
)

(defun bit-combinations ( l / foo bar )
    (defun foo ( l r )
        (if (and l (< 1 r))
            (append (mapcar '(lambda ( x ) (+ (car l) x)) (foo (cdr l) (1- r))) (foo (cdr l) r))
            l
        )
    )
    (defun bar ( l r )
        (if (< 0 r) (append (bar l (1- r)) (foo l r)))
    )
    (cons 0 (bar l (length l)))
)

Hence, for aligned dimensions:
Code: [Select]
_$ (dim-filter 1)
((0 . "*DIMENSION") (-4 . "<OR") (70 . 1) (70 . 33) (70 . 65) (70 . 129) (70 . 97) (70 . 161) (70 . 193) (70 . 225) (-4 . "OR>"))
